When it comes to premium leggings, Koral has quickly risen as a top contender in the activewear market, known for combining style, comfort, and performance. However, the market is full of other high-end brands that also promise quality and innovation. This article compares Koral leggings with other premium leggings to help you understand which might be the better choice for your needs.
1. Fabric and Material Quality
Koral Leggings:
Koral is celebrated for its proprietary Alosoft fabric, which feels exceptionally soft and luxurious against the skin. Their leggings often feature moisture-wicking and quick-dry technology, making them perfect for high-intensity workouts or everyday wear. The fabric also offers excellent stretch and shape retention, ensuring comfort and durability.
Other Premium Leggings:
Brands like Lululemon, Alo Yoga, and Athleta also offer premium fabrics with features such as four-way stretch, sweat-wicking, and anti-odor technology. Each brand uses slightly different blends, from nylon-spandex to polyester-based fabrics, targeting different preferences in softness, compression, and breathability.
2. Fit and Comfort
Koral Leggings:
Koral leggings are designed with a sleek, contouring fit that sculpts the body without feeling restrictive. The high-rise waistband offers strong support, and many styles include seamless or flatlock stitching to minimize irritation.
Other Premium Leggings:
Competitors like Lululemon’s Align leggings focus heavily on buttery softness and a second-skin fit, sometimes prioritizing comfort over compression. Alo Yoga leggings often feature more fashion-forward cuts and mesh inserts for breathability, while Athleta balances comfort and functionality for active lifestyles.

4. Durability and Longevity
Koral Leggings:
Thanks to high-quality stitching and robust fabric blends, Koral leggings are known for their durability. They hold up well after multiple washes without losing shape or color.
Other Premium Leggings:
Lululemon and Athleta leggings also score high in durability, often reinforced with sturdy stitching and quality materials. However, some ultra-soft leggings from competitors might show wear sooner, depending on fabric type and care.
